Transaction 28dd7176307a61d34d063b89b7f653e88b2afc2857e5934b9541d6f4d437356a

1 Input
2 Outputs
  • 28dd7176307a61d34d063b89b7f653e88b2afc2857e5934b9541d6f4d437356a:0
  • value  3445678
    address  3PUgJSsvFv6Pd48gfPAGBsmwLofJbrKFTa
  • 28dd7176307a61d34d063b89b7f653e88b2afc2857e5934b9541d6f4d437356a:1
  • value  25346920
    address  1FY5JKfDTspuNkwyMMczR2GRSD16G5Augd